"Cucumber should be well sliced, dressed with pepper and vinegar, and then thrown out."

100 likes

Source: In James Boswell 'Journal of a Tour to the Hebrides' (1785) 5 October 1773

Samuel Johnson

Lexicographer, Essayist, Critic

Samuel Johnson was an 18th-century English writer and lexicographer, known for his influential work 'A Dictionary of the English Language' and his profound insights into human nature.
